The 2012 World Superbike season got underway at Phillip Island in Australia last weekend, and the past two champions both laid down early markers to clinch this year’s title. Aprilia’s Max Biaggi won the first race of the new campaign, capitalizing on a mistake by reigning champ Carlos Checa who crashed out while leading.
